Section 13-1-8 - Contract defined - Entire and severable contracts
(a) A contract may be either entire or severable. In an entire contract, the whole contract stands or falls together. In a severable contract, the failure of a distinct part does not void the remainder.
(b) The character of the contract in such case is determined by the intention of the parties.
